I also just picked up some Electro-Voice LS-12 Wolverine 12″ full-range speakers in some original-equipment enclosures. they look neat. And when I opened them up the Wolverines are in time-warp condition. My initial testing found everything was OK but I’m not sold on the sound yet – in the enclosures there’s a lot less low end than I was expecting. Maybe this is a good time to experiment with open baffles.
